首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 来自专栏有点技术

    kubeedge 管理raspberry DHT11温度模块

    wpa_supplicant.conf -i wlan0 # 查看连接状态 cat /proc/net/wireless # 分配IP dhcient wlano 连接 ssh ubuntu@ip 使用树莓派控制DHT 11 温度传感器 安装Python Adafruit库 apt-get install build-essential python-dev sudo git clone https://github.com Adafruit_Python_DHT.git cd Adafruit_Python_DHT python setup.py install 运行测试程序 cd Adafruit_Python_DHT cd examples # 11 代表DHT11模块 17,4代表针脚 # 我这里 VCC:1 DATA:7 GND:6 python AdafruitDHT.py 11 4 如果正常返回则没问题 针脚编号表 ? raw.githubusercontent.com/du2016/kubeedge-examples/master/kubeedge-temperature-demo/crds/device.yaml 加载温度

    1.1K10发布于 2020-07-14
  • 来自专栏kali blog

    Esp8266 DHC11 OLED制作室内温度

    Digital pin connected to the DHT sensor // Uncomment the type of sensor in use: #define DHTTYPE DHT11 // DHT 11 //#define DHTTYPE DHT22 // DHT 22 (AM2302) //#define DHTTYPE DHT21 // DHT

    1K20编辑于 2021-12-17
  • 来自专栏WOLFRAM

    华氏温度和摄氏温度

    华氏温度和摄氏温度在生活中的使用非常常见 用C和F来表示下面面板上的每一个刻度 两种温度之间的转化公式 F = 32 + 9/5 * C C =

    2.4K20发布于 2018-05-31
  • 来自专栏c++与qt学习

    每日温度

    暴力求解法: class Solution { public: vector<int> dailyTemperatures(vector<int>& T) { vector<int> ret; ret.resize(T.size(),0); cout << ret.size() << endl; for (int i = 0; i < T.size(); i++) {

    1.2K10编辑于 2022-05-05
  • 来自专栏没事多喝水

    每日温度

    请根据每日 气温 列表,重新生成一个列表。对应位置的输出为:要想观测到更高的气温,至少需要等待的天数。如果气温在这之后都不会升高,请在该位置用 0 来代替。

    1.1K20发布于 2020-11-20
  • 来自专栏WindCoder

    摄氏温度——华氏温度对照表

    /* 功能:摄氏温度——华氏温度对照表 日期:2013-05-08 */ #include <stdio.h> #include <stdlib.h> #include <math.h> int main(void) { int C; double F; printf("摄氏温度 华氏温度n"); C = 0; F = C; do { F = (double)C * 9 / 5

    1.3K10发布于 2018-09-20
  • 来自专栏前端小书童

    一天一大 leet(每日温度)难度:中等 DAY-11

    题目(难度:简单): 根据每日 气温 列表,请重新生成一个列表,对应位置的输出是需要再等待多久温度才会升高超过该日的天数。如果之后都不会升高,请在该位置用 0 来代替。 对于每个元素 T[i],在数组 next 中找到从 T[i] + 1 到 100 中每个温度第一次出现的下标, 将其中的最小下标记为 warmerIndex,则 warmerIndex 为下一次温度比当天高的下标 如果 warmerIndex 不为无穷大,则 warmerIndex - i 即为下一次温度比当天高的等待天数,最后令 next[T[i]] = i。 为什么上述做法可以保证正确呢? 因为遍历温度列表的方向是反向,当遍历到元素 T[i] 时, 只有 T[i] 后面的元素被访问过,即对于任意 t,当 next[t] 不为无穷大时,一定存在 j 使得 t 等于 T[j] 且 i < j。 又由于遍历到温度列表中的每个元素时都会更新数组 next 中的对应温度的元素值, 因此对于任意 t,当 next[t] 不为无穷大时,令 j = next[t],则 j 是满足 t 等于 T[j] 且

    34030发布于 2020-09-24
  • 来自专栏来自IT的我

    温度的数据,需要有温度的存储

    西部数据公司高级副总裁兼中国及亚太区总经理 Steven Craig 有温度数据,有温度的盘 西部数据创新存储架构分层存储模型将数据划分为快数据、大数据,分别对应于性能、容量的存储需求。 ? 有温度的盘,有温度的存储设计 有温度的数据,有温度的盘给存储系统设计带来了新的机遇。 HDD磁盘为例,从14TB 到18TB,带来了更大容量、更低功耗和更高效率,也带来数据中心总拥有成本的进一步降低,其中数据功耗是主要的成本开支,被降低了21%;不仅如此,使用大容量HDD硬盘还可以减少11% ,采用全新自研存储架构设计,配合使用新的20TB SMR磁盘,创造性的将数据存储的成本GB/月拉低到了0.024元的水平,同比采用CMR磁盘的标准存储系统,成本降低80%,同时确保享有与标准存储相同的11 人尽其才、物尽其用,有温度的数据,需要有温度的存储系统设计。否则的话,“没有声音,再好的戏也出不来啊!“

    1.9K10发布于 2021-02-19
  • 来自专栏伪君子的梦呓

    华氏温度转摄氏温度~ C++ 做法

    题目: 描述: 输入一个华氏温度,要求输出摄氏温度。公式为 C=5(F-32)/9,取两位小数。 输入: 一个华氏温度,浮点数 输出: 摄氏温度 ,浮点两位小数 样例输入: -40 样例输出: c = -40.00 题目链接:http://www.dotcpp.com/oj/problem1005. iostream> #include<iomanip> //精度控制头文件 using namespace std; int main() { float Fahrenheit; //华式温度 cin >> Fahrenheit; float Celsius; //摄氏温度 Celsius = 5 * (Fahrenheit - 32) / 9; //公式 C=5

    3.8K30发布于 2018-08-03
  • 来自专栏Linux学习日志

    esp8266+DHT11温湿传感器 制作web室内温度

    设备清单 (esp8266)NodeMCU开发板一块 DHT11温湿度传感器一个 DHT11模块 ? NodeMcu板子 ? DHT11是通过测量两个电极之间的电阻来检测水蒸汽的。 NodeMCU连接DHT11 ? 将DHT11连接到NodeMCU是比较简单的,但连接方式有所不同,具体取决于您使用的是3个引脚的传感器还是4个引脚的传感器。 连接方式如下 DHT11上标有(+或VCC)引脚的连接nodemcu的+ 3V引脚。 DHT11上标有(S或OUT)引脚的连接nodemcu的D4V引脚。 ptr +="</svg>\n"; ptr +="

    \n"; ptr +="
    室内温度 )Humiditystat; ptr +="%
    \n"; ptr +="
    \n"; //定义温度变量

8.2K20发布于 2020-08-27
  • 来自专栏landv

    C语言温度

    argc, char *argv[]) { int i; int fahr,celsius; int lower,upper,step; lower = 0;//温度表的下限 upper = 300;//温度表的上限 step = 20;//步长 fahr = lower; while(fahr<=upper){

    93330发布于 2018-05-24
  • 来自专栏GEE数据专栏,GEE学习专栏,GEE错误集等专栏

    Google Earth Engine——全球地表温度夜间产品的基础数据集是MODIS陆地表面温度数据(MOD11A2)

    The underlying dataset for this daytime product is MODIS land surface temperature data (MOD11A2), which 该日间产品的基础数据集是MODIS陆地表面温度数据(MOD11A2),采用Weiss等人(2014)所述的方法填补缺口,以消除由云层等因素造成的数据缺失。

    53510编辑于 2024-02-02
  • 来自专栏数据结构与算法

    温度转换

    题目描述 将输入的华氏温度转换为摄氏温度。由华氏温度F与摄氏温度C的转换公式为:F=C×9/5+32。 输入 输入一个实数,表示华氏温度 输出 输出对应的摄氏温度,答案保留4位小数。

    1.3K120发布于 2018-04-12
  • 来自专栏算法与编程之美

    算法创作|华氏温度与摄氏温度的转换问题

    温度转换的计算公式:C=5×(F−32)/9,其中:C表示摄氏温度,F表示华氏温度。输出华氏-摄氏温度转换表 输入:在一行中输入2个整数,分别表示lower和upper的值,中间用英文逗号分开。 输出:第一行输出:“fahr celsius”,接着每行输出一个华氏温度fahr(整型)与一个摄氏温度celsius(占据6个字符宽度,靠右对齐,保留1位小数)。 解决方案 问题是要把华氏温度转化为摄氏温度,所以我们先应该对华氏温度给定一个范围,再在lower和upper限定的范围里进行转换。 先要判断输入的lower和upper的大小关系,进行分类讨论,再循环输出给定范围内的所有华氏温度的摄氏温度。 结语 本次算法创作我们小组就华氏温度与摄氏温度的转换进行了研究,本次我们用到了map函数,if的条件判断与while循环语句,看似很简单的一个问题,其实有多种解法:for循环、while循环。

    1.7K20发布于 2021-03-30
  • 来自专栏云原生拾遗

    Linux 查看CPU温度

    话说,托管在IDC机房的服务器需要关注硬件温度么? 安装温度传感器工具不安装驱动无法读取传感器数据sudo apt install lm-sensors探测温度传感器免确认执行命令yes | sensors-detect查看硬件温度sensors

    13.6K20编辑于 2023-07-17
  • 来自专栏GEE数据专栏,GEE学习专栏,GEE错误集等专栏

    Google Earth Engine——全球地表温度日间产品的基础数据集是MODIS陆地表面温度数据(MOD11A2)

    The underlying dataset for this daytime product is MODIS land surface temperature data (MOD11A2), which 该日间产品的基础数据集是MODIS陆地表面温度数据(MOD11A2),采用Weiss等人(2014)所述的方法填补缺口,以消除由云层等因素造成的数据缺失。

    66121编辑于 2024-02-02
  • 来自专栏软件工程

    每日温度

    下来循环temperatures进行栈的操作,循环过程中,持续判断当前下标温度与栈顶下标温度的大小差别 如果当前下标的温度大于栈顶下标的温度,表示找到了下一个更大的温度,弹出栈顶下标,计算天数差别, 更新 res[栈顶下标] = 当前下标 - 栈顶下标 否则将当前下标加入栈顶 res中没有更新的元素,表示未找到更高的温度,最终返回ret即可。 temperatures * @return */ public int[] dailyTemperatures(int[] temperatures) { //存储没找到更高温度的下标

    54510编辑于 2022-01-12
  • 来自专栏C/C++与音视频

    GPU温度的采集

    GPU硬件参数越来得到开发人员的关注,对GPU 温度,占用率,显存等参数也纳入监控平台的重要监控指标。本文以温度为例介绍如何监控显卡GPU相关参数。 Windows资源监控管理器,能看到GPU各种占有率参数,但看不到GPU的温度,且通过这UI种方式只能在Windows系统中查看,无法将数据传的传输后台监控。 不足之处如下: 每采集一次温度调一次命令行,相当于启动一个进程,有一定开销。或者该命令行常驻执行,每N秒刷新一次参数,但如果被用户干掉了也就麻烦了,需要写一个守护程序保护这个进程。 英伟达显卡API采集温度实现: 我们通过调用英伟达的SDK提供的API完成一个demo如下: 资源下载地址:https://download.csdn.net/download/fengliang191 /12538530 AMD显卡API采集温度实现: AMD显卡我们通过调用显卡驱动自带的dll库提供的API来完成温度参数的采集(AMD显卡比较坑,库中有几套API,不同显卡API还不一样,如果遇到API

    1.5K20编辑于 2022-06-14
  • 来自专栏健程之道

    力扣739——每日温度

    ),队列中的结构需要记录温度和天数。 接下来看看代码: class Solution { public int[] dailyTemperatures(int[] T) { // 以温度为排序依据的小顶堆,温度越低越靠前 queue.add(node); // 取队列中最小的元素 Node newNode = queue.peek(); // 如果队列中最低温度就是当前温度 我们还是从后向前遍历,在栈中存储气温的天数,当前遍历到的温度,如果比栈顶的存储的天数对应的温度高,那么栈中存储的是没有意义的;如果比它低,那么就可以更新结果了。 stack.isEmpty() && T[i] >= T[stack.peek()]) { // 因为当前温度比栈顶存储的温度高, //

    70430发布于 2020-02-26
  • 来自专栏kali blog

    获取树莓派的温度

    如何简单方便的获取当前树莓派的运行温度呢? 方法一: 进入操作目录 cd /sys/class/thermal/thermal_zone0 查看温度 cat temp 树莓派的返回值 37540 返回值除以1000为当前CPU温度值。 即当前温度为37摄氏度。 方法二:利用python获取树莓派的温度 #-*- coding: utf-8 -*- #打开文件 file = open("/sys/class/thermal/thermal_zone0/temp file.close() #向控制台打印 print "temp : %.1f" %temp 执行脚本 python wd.py 执行返回 temp : 37.2 通过这两种方法,我们便实现了树莓派温度的获取

    1.7K20编辑于 2021-12-19
  • 领券